insignificant, but next up is proper stack frame layout!
authorDuraid Madina <duraid@octopus.com.au>
Sat, 21 Jan 2006 14:27:19 +0000 (14:27 +0000)
committerDuraid Madina <duraid@octopus.com.au>
Sat, 21 Jan 2006 14:27:19 +0000 (14:27 +0000)
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@25497 91177308-0d34-0410-b5e6-96231b3b80d8

lib/Target/IA64/IA64ISelDAGToDAG.cpp

index a0f6ac2f6f864f3d6ed7208e70a01c02b0bb2138..6329be8111d1b041b53d6f41759e2f47766bb85f 100644 (file)
@@ -464,7 +464,8 @@ SDOperand IA64DAGToDAGISel::Select(SDOperand Op) {
     if (N->hasOneUse())
       return CurDAG->SelectNodeTo(N, IA64::MOV, MVT::i64,
                                   CurDAG->getTargetFrameIndex(FI, MVT::i64));
-    return CurDAG->getTargetNode(IA64::MOV, MVT::i64,
+    else
+      return CodeGenMap[Op] = CurDAG->getTargetNode(IA64::MOV, MVT::i64,
                                 CurDAG->getTargetFrameIndex(FI, MVT::i64));
   }